Pengetahuan dan perilaku ramah lingkungan mahasiswa
Human lifestyle behaviors today still pose environmental problems, including waste accumulation leading to pollution of water sources consumed by humans, resulting in a health crisis. One strategy that needs to be undertaken is a change in community behavior towards cleaner and more efficient consumption patterns. However, significant impacts on consumption patterns will not be significant if only one or two individuals do so. Good cooperation and sufficient knowledge are required to form collective awareness in environmentally friendly behavior. In relation to this, this scientific work examines the correlation between environmentally friendly behavior of Environmental Science students and income, age, gender, and educational background of SIL UI students. This research was conducted by surveying 47 students of the Environmental Science School UI batch 40A. The results of this study show that income has a slight correlation with the four dimensions of environmentally friendly behavior: recycling, transportation & mobility, energy conservation, and environmentally friendly consumption
The impact of willingness to pay, environmental awareness, consumer behavior, consumer attitudes toward purchase decisions on sustainable packaging in Indonesia
Background: Packaging is considered a vital component of the marketing mix. Sustainable Packaging is packaging that is very important to use in Indonesia because of the large amount of environmental damage due to plastic waste and the large amount of plastic waste that we usually find in waterways which causes flooding everywhere. Environmental Awareness is one of the reasons for increasing public awareness to reduce the use of plastic waste and to start switching to sustainable packaging. In Indonesia, they have started to use sustainable packaging, but public awareness is still lacking and sometimes they still like to use plastic. The purpose of this research is to examine the impact of willingness to pay, environmental awareness, consumer behavior, and consumer attitudes toward purchasing decisions on sustainable packaging in Indonesia. Methods: A quantitative method was used as the research design method by conducting online questionnaires. The questionnaires were distributed online for those who have an intention to sustainable packaging in Indonesia. The total respondents in this research are 153. The data analysis design that is used in this research is Partial Least Square-based Structural Equation Modeling (PLS-SEM) using Smart-PLS software 4 starting from the measurement of the outer model, inner model, and hypothesis testing. Findings: This study has 4 hypotheses and the results show that willingness to pay, environmental awareness, consumer behavior, and consumer attitudes directly impact purchase decisions. Conclusion: Willingness to pay and consumer behavior significantly impact purchase decisions regarding sustainable packaging, whereas environmental awareness does not. Novelty/Originality of this Study: This comprehensive examination investigates how willingness to pay, environmental awareness, consumer behavior, and consumer attitudes specifically influence purchase decisions on sustainable packaging within the unique socio-economic and cultural context of Indonesia. By using Partial Least Squares-based Structural Equation Modeling (PLS-SEM), the study provides nuanced insights into the direct impacts of these variables, an area that is relatively unexplored in Indonesian market dynamics
Identification of rodent species confirmed as the cause of leptospirosis disease with ecosystem distribution and environmental factors
Background: Leptospirosis outbreaks have been reported in various parts of the world, classifying it as a re-emerging infectious disease. Rats act as the main reservoir for Leptospira spp. bacteria. The Indonesian Ministry of Health reported 1,170 cases of leptospirosis with 106 deaths Case Fatality Rate (CFR 9.1%) in 2020, obtained from 8 provinces. Additionally, in 2021, there was a decrease in cases by 734, but with an increased CFR of 11.4%, with the largest contributors being Central Java and East Java. Objective: To determine the most dominant rodent species confirmed to cause leptospirosis and the distribution of ecosystems and environmental factors that are the dominant causes of leptospirosis. Methods: This paper is a narrative literature review study. Articles were searched through online databases such as Google Scholar and PubMed using keywords leptospirosis, rats, ecosystem, and environmental factors, published within the last 5 years. Findings: The identification results showed that Bandicota indica was the most dominant rodent species infected with leptospirosis. This type of rat is a commensal species. Leptospirosis cases occurred in non-forest ecosystems near settlements and coastal areas near settlements. The dominant environmental factors associated with leptospirosis incidence were poor sanitation conditions, indiscriminate waste disposal behavior, and stagnant water. Conclusion: The identification results indicate that Bandicota indica is the most dominant rodent species infected with leptospirosis, being a commensal rat species in non-forest ecosystems near settlements and coastal areas near settlements. The dominant environmental factors associated with leptospirosis incidence include poor sanitation conditions, indiscriminate waste disposal behavior, and stagnant water. Novelty/Originality of this Study: The study's findings confirmed that non-forest and coastal ecosystems near settlements are significant reservoirs for Leptospira bacteria. Additionally, it highlighted the critical role of poor sanitation, indiscriminate waste disposal, and stagnant water as environmental factors contributing to the transmission of leptospirosis
Assessment of macrozoobenthic community dynamics in the Ijuk River: Implications for freshwater ecosystem health and conservation management
Background: Nestled within the Isau-Isau Wildlife Reserve, the Ijuk River stretches approximately three kilometers, serving as a vital conservation area. Its upstream region plays multiple ecological roles, including watershed management, hydrological regulation, microclimate control, soil fertility maintenance, microbial habitat provision, air quality regulation, and carbon sequestration. However, escalating human activities, particularly changes in land use, pose significant threats to its ecological balance. The particular concern is the conversion of forested areas into agricultural lands, primarily for coffee cultivation and mixed gardens, encroaching dangerously close to the riverbanks. This encroachment necessitates a critical reevaluation of the river's water quality, given its crucial role in supporting biodiversity and ecological equilibrium. Benthic insects dwelling in the riverbed serve as invaluable bioindicators, offering insights into the overall health of aquatic ecosystems. Methods: Conducted between January and July 2022 in the Isau-Isau Wildlife Refuge, Lawang Agung Village, Mulak Ulu District, Lahat Regency, the study aimed to assess the macrozoobenthic community structure across three river segments: upstream, midstream, and downstream. Employing field sampling, observational surveys, taxonomic identification, and data analysis, the research aimed to unravel the river's ecological dynamics. Findings: Through meticulous examination of benthic insect communities, the study revealed relatively favorable water quality in the Ijuk River. However, discernible declines in various ecological parameters, as evidenced by evaluation results, highlight the urgency of conservation efforts and proactive management strategies to mitigate further degradation and preserve the river's ecological integrity. Conclusion: Such endeavors are crucial for safeguarding the biodiversity and sustainability of this vital freshwater ecosystem. Novelty/Originality of this Study: The study uniquely assesses the macrozoobenthic community dynamics in the Ijuk River, revealing significant changes over two decades that highlight the river's ecological health and underscore the urgent need for conservation efforts. It offers a comprehensive, updated evaluation of the macrozoobenthic community structure, providing critical insights into the impacts of land use changes and human activities on freshwater ecosystems
Analysis of the phenomenon of keeping endangered animals as a trend
Indonesia is a country with diverse fauna. However, many animals are experiencing an extinction crisis, one of the causes is the exploitation of these rare animals, one of which is for free keeping. Wild animals have natural instincts that evolved with their evolution and help them survive in their natural habitat. When wild animals are kept in different environments, such as captivity or shelters, they often lose or change some aspects of their original instincts. The protection of rare and endangered wildlife species is of international concern, as biodiversity conservation is essential for survival. Unfortunately, the enforcement of these protected wildlife regulations is not strict enough and there are still many violations, so it is important for the Indonesian government and its citizens to work together to ensure effective implementation of wildlife protection regulations. This research method uses a qualitative approach with data collection from literature studies and uses interpretation analysis techniques. The importance of wildlife conservation in Indonesia cannot be ignored. It is important for Indonesians to follow applicable regulations and participate in protected wildlife conservation efforts to maintain the country's biodiversity. This study illustrates the factors that lead to the keeping of wild and endangered animals and the role of the government in this regard and answers how the phenomenon has become a trend in high society
Sikap peduli lingkungan masyarakat: Studi kasus masyarakat kota Bandung
The environment plays an important role in human life as a place of interaction between organisms. Every individual should have an attitude of caring about the environment in order to maintain the sustainability of life. This research aims to analyze people's environmental care attitudes and understand the supporting factors. This research uses a quantitative approach with a survey method complemented by interviews and observations. The sampling technique used was quota sampling, with sampling limited to 70 in the Bandung City area. The attitude of caring for the environment in society and students in terms of knowledge is already in a good category, but has not been implemented well. Factors that influence this include unclear legal policy regulations, the lack of a culture of social discipline, and the rise of consumer culture which contributes to more waste. Efforts are needed to increase attitudes that care about the environment with guidance, seminars, education and invitations on social media

Instrumen pencegahan pencemaran lingkungan akibat pestisida
Praktik penggunaan pestisida kimia oleh para petani di seluruh dunia yang berlebihan sudah terjadi sejak lama dan membuat bahayanya semakin parah untuk lingkungan. Telah banyak peneliti mengungkap bahwa penggunaan pestisida kimia akan berdampak pada lingkungan. Bahwa penggunaan pestisida kimia tidak efisien karena dari sejumlah pestisida kimia yang diaplikasikan, hanya satu persen yang tertuju pada sasaran. Salah satu jenis pestisida kimia yang umum digunakan di Indonesia sejak tahun 1950 adalah pestisida kimia yang berbahan dasar zat aktif karbofuran. Penelitian ini menggunakan sistem deskriptif literature review. Penelitian ini menemukan Kebijakan baru dalam peredaran pestisida kimia di Indonesia sangat diperlukan apabila ditinjau melalui kasus kerusakan lahan dan dampaknya bagi kesehatan. Kebijakan tersebut sifatnya harus adaptable agar dapat menyesuaikan perkembangan teknologi pertanian di masa depan
Strategi peningkatan perilaku peduli lingkungan ditinjau dari implementasi sistem manajemen lingkungan
Permasalahan lingkungan masih menjadi fokus utama. Lingkungan dan manusia memiliki hubungan yang saling mempengaruhi. Tekanan pada lingkungan menjadi permasalahan lingkungan dengan tumbuhnya sektor industri. Perkembangan industri yang meningkat menyebabkan meningkatnya jumlah pencemaran. Salah satu cara pengelolaan lingkungan untuk mengatasi dampak yang terjadi pada lingkungan di Perusahaan dengan cara menerapkan standar Sistem Manajemen Lingkungan (SML) ISO 14001. PT. X bergerak di bidang jasa transportasi sudah menerapkan SML ISO 14001 sejak tahun 2014. Hasil observasi didapatkan beberapa titik lokasi tempat sampah terdapat sampah yang tercampur. Metode penelitian yang digunakan kombinasi kuantitatif dan kualitatif.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an terdapat hubungan positif dan cukup kuat antara Sistem Manajemen Lingkungan (SML) ISO 14001 dengan perilaku peduli lingkungan dan strategi yang diperlukan untuk meningkatkan perilaku peduli lingkungan adalah pengembangan sumberdaya manusia, membangun komitmen, dan sinergisitas antara perusahaan dengan pemerintah
Analisis hubungan Sistem Manajemen Lingkungan (SML) ISO 14001 dengan perilaku peduli lingkungan
Permasalahan lingkungan yang dihadapi dunia saat ini semakin lama semakin berat karena semakin hari jumlah penduduk bertambah banyak. Permasalahan lingkungan terus terjadi, padahal peran lingkungan begitu penting untuk memenuhi kebutuhan manusia. Jika manusia tidak bijak dalam mengelola lingkungan maka lingkungan akan rusak, baik dari segi kualitas ataupun kuantitasnya. Salah satu perusahaan di wilayah Tangerang, terus berupaya meningkatkan kinerja lingkungannya. Perusahaan ini bergerak di bidang jasa pengurusan transportasi (JPT) atau freight forwarding di Indonesia, perusahaan ikut berperan dalam pengelolaan lingkungan sebagai bagian dari komitmen global dengan mempertimbangkan risiko-risiko yang ada dalam setiap kegiatan yang dikelolanya. Perusahaan berusaha untuk peduli pada lingkungan dalam pelaksanaan kegiatan usahanya dengan melakukan sertifikasi SML ISO 14001 sejak tahun 2014 sebagai komitmen global dalam perlindungan pada lingkungan. Tujuan umum penelitian ini adalah mengetahui cara peningkatan perilaku peduli lingkungan untuk mengoptimalkan kinerja Sistem Manajemen Lingkungan (SML) ISO 14001 melalui analisis hubungan Sistem Manajemen Lingkungan (SML) ISO 14001 dengan perilaku peduli lingkungan. Pendekatan penelitian yang digunakan dalam ini adalah pendekatan kuantitatif dengan analisis Bivariat. Terdapat hubungan positif dan cukup kuat antara Sistem Manajemen Lingkungan (SML) ISO 14001 dengan perilaku peduli lingkungan yang artinya semakin tinggi pemahaman karyawan terkait SML ISO 14001 maka semakin baik perilaku peduli lingkungan. Terdapat hubungan yang positif dan kuat antara pemahaman karyawan terkait lingkungan dengan Sistem Manajemen Lingkungan (SML) ISO 14001 terhadap perilaku peduli lingkungan yang artinya jika karyawan memiliki pemahaman keduanya antara pemahaman terkait lingkungan dan pemahaman terkait SML ISO 14001 maka semakin jauh lebih baik perilaku peduli lingkungan pada karyawan
